Lindsay Lohan has faced her fair share of criticism for her performance in David Mamet’s play, Speed-the-Plow, at London’s West End Playhouse Theater, but a close friend of the actress tell RadarOnline.com exclusively that “all of the bad press she has gotten is simply not true.”

“A bunch of her friends went to see the show and, despite what you hear, she gave a really solid performance,” a friend of the Liz & Dick actress says.

“She did not get handed her lines and was really funny. The audience had a great reaction to her.”

As RadarOnline.com previously reported, Lohan, 28, “doesn’t even slightly care what people are saying and she will audition for more plays because she really likes doing theater,” according to a source close to the actress.

“She is in a really good place right now and we are all really proud of her,” the friend tells RadarOnline.com.

“It seems like the old Lindsay is back. She looks great and she has allowed us all back into her life.”

Speed-the-Plow, which will run until Nov. 29, is directed by Lindsay Posner and also stars Richard Schiff and Nigel Lindsay.
